One prominent feature of modern marine propulsion systems is their integration of advanced technologies such as hybrid and fully electric systems. These solutions not only enhance fuel efficiency but also reduce emissions, adhering to strict environmental regulations. Furthermore, the ability to switch between power sources allows vessels to optimize performance based on operational demands, making these systems versatile for various maritime applications.
While advanced propulsion technologies offer numerous benefits, they also come with certain drawbacks. The initial investment for such systems can be substantial, posing a barrier for smaller operators. Moreover, transitioning to new technologies may require additional training for crew members, which could lead to operational downtime during the switch. Therefore, marine propulsion solutions providers must highlight the long-term savings and environmental benefits to justify the upfront costs.

Cost considerations remain a significant factor in the decision-making process. Users have reported that while some state-of-the-art propulsion systems might seem expensive initially, they often provide substantial savings on fuel and maintenance in the long run. Additionally, the increasing focus on sustainable practices has led many operators to consider the environmental impact of their choices, further influencing their willingness to invest in more efficient systems.
